2023 Dublin Literary Award Ceremony
By International Literature Festival Dublin
The world’s most valuable annual prize for a single work of fiction, the Dublin Literary Award is open to all novelists writing in, or translated into, English. Unique in its nomination process, titles are nominated each year by public libraries in major cities across the world, making it a true reader’s accolade.
The 2023 Award winner will be chosen from a diverse and dynamic international shortlist which includes four novels in translation and a debut novelist. This year, the 28th winner of the Dublin Literary Award will be announced by its Patron, Lord Mayor Caroline Conroy.
Many of the nominated novels for the 2023 Dublin Literary Award are available for readers to borrow from public libraries or on digital loan from BorrowBox. Both the prize and ILFD are sponsored solely by Dublin City Council.
